Запитання з тегом «arrays»

Масив - це упорядкована лінійна структура даних, що складається з набору елементів (значень, змінних чи посилань), кожен ідентифікований одним або кількома індексами. Запитуючи про конкретні варіанти масивів, використовуйте замість цих тегів: [вектор], [масив], [матриця]. Використовуючи цей тег, у питанні, яке є специфічним для мови програмування, позначте це питання мовою програмування, яка використовується.

11
Перетворити рядок Swift в масив
Як можна перетворити рядок "Привіт" в масив ["H", "e", "l", "l", "o"] у Swift? У Objective-C я використав це: NSMutableArray *characters = [[NSMutableArray alloc] initWithCapacity:[myString length]]; for (int i=0; i < [myString length]; i++) { NSString *ichar = [NSString stringWithFormat:@"%c", [myString characterAtIndex:i]]; [characters addObject:ichar]; }
133 ios  arrays  swift  string 

6
Як я можу ініціалізувати масив String довжиною 0 в Java?
Java Docs для методу String[] java.io.File.list(FilenameFilter filter) включає це в опис повернення: Масив буде порожнім, якщо каталог порожній або якщо фільтр не прийняв імен. Як я можу зробити подібну річ і ініціалізувати масив String (або будь-який інший масив для цього питання), щоб мати довжину 0?

13
Будь-яка оптимізація для випадкового доступу на дуже великому масиві, коли значення в 95% випадків дорівнює 0 або 1?
Чи можлива оптимізація випадкового доступу на дуже великому масиві (я зараз використовую uint8_tі запитую про те, що краще) uint8_t MyArray[10000000]; коли значення в будь-якій позиції масиву є 0 або 1 для 95% усіх випадків, 2 у 4% випадків, між 3 і 255 в інших 1% випадків? Отже, чи є для …

8
Javascript ES6 / ES5 знайти у масиві та зміни
У мене є масив об’єктів. Я хочу знайти якесь поле, а потім змінити його: var item = {...} var items = [{id:2}, {id:2}, {id:2}]; var foundItem = items.find(x => x.id == item.id); foundItem = item; Я хочу, щоб він змінив оригінальний об’єкт. Як? (Мені байдуже, чи буде це в лодаші)

8
Визначте, чи JSON є JSONObject або JSONArray
Я збираюся отримувати або сервер JSON або масив від сервера, але я не маю уявлення, яким це буде. Мені потрібно працювати з JSON, але для цього мені потрібно знати, чи це Об'єкт чи масив. Я працюю з Android. Хтось має хороший спосіб зробити це?
132 android  arrays  json  object 


13
Зробіть var_dump красивим
У мене є простий $_GET[]набір варіантів запитів для показу даних тестування під час витягування запитів із БД. <?php if($_GET['test']): ?> <div id="test" style="padding: 24px; background: #fff; text-align: center;"> <table> <tr style="font-weight: bold;"><td>MLS</td></tr> <tr><td><?php echo KEY; ?></td></tr> <tr style="font-weight: bold;"><td>QUERY</td></tr> <tr><td><?php echo $data_q; ?></td></tr> <tr style="font-weight: bold;"><td>DATA</td></tr> <tr><td><?php var_dump($data); ?></td></tr> </table> …
132 php  arrays  var-dump 


10
Чому компілятори C і C ++ допускають довжину масивів у підписах функцій, коли вони ніколи не застосовуються?
Це те, що я виявив під час свого навчання: #include<iostream> using namespace std; int dis(char a[1]) { int length = strlen(a); char c = a[2]; return length; } int main() { char b[4] = "abc"; int c = dis(b); cout << c; return 0; } Тож у змінній int dis(char …
131 c++  c  arrays 

10
PHP-нечутлива до in_array функція
Чи можливо провести порівняння з урахуванням регістру при використанні in_arrayфункції? Отже, з таким джерелом: $a= array( 'one', 'two', 'three', 'four' ); Усі наступні пошукові запити повертають би істину: in_array('one', $a); in_array('two', $a); in_array('ONE', $a); in_array('fOUr', $a); Яка функція чи набір функцій зробили б те саме? Я не думаю, що in_arrayсам …
131 php  arrays 

8
як множення відрізняється для класів NumPy Matrix проти масиву?
Документи nummy рекомендують використовувати масив замість матриці для роботи з матрицями. Однак, на відміну від октави (якою я користувався донедавна), * не виконує множення матриць, вам потрібно використовувати функцію matrixmultipy (). Я вважаю, що це робить код дуже нечитабельним. Хтось поділяє мої погляди і знайшов рішення?

2
Java: масив int ініціалізується з ненульовими елементами
Згідно JLS, intмасив повинен бути заповнений нулями відразу після ініціалізації. Однак я зіткнувся з ситуацією, коли це не так. Така поведінка виникає спочатку в JDK 7u4, а також відбувається у всіх пізніших оновленнях (я використовую 64-бітну реалізацію). Наступний код кидає виняток: public static void main(String[] args) { int[] a; int …

4
Як повернути масив з JNI на Java?
Я намагаюся використовувати андроїд NDK. Чи є спосіб повернути int[]на Яву масив (в моєму випадку an ), створений в JNI? Якщо так, будь ласка, надайте короткий приклад функції JNI, яка б це зробила. -Дякую



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.